Welcome to our blog post on understanding the concept of cybersecurity programming. In today’s digital age, cybersecurity has become more important than ever to protect our online data and privacy. This post will delve into the basics of cybersecurity programming, covering key concepts and techniques to secure our digital assets.
The Basics of Cybersecurity Programming
Cybersecurity programming involves developing software and applications that protect against cyber threats such as malware, viruses, and hacking. It is essential to understand programming languages like Python, Java, and C++ to create secure systems that can detect and prevent cyber attacks.
Common Cybersecurity Programming Techniques
One common technique used in cybersecurity programming is encryption, which involves encoding data to make it unreadable to unauthorized users. Another technique is authentication, which verifies the identity of the user before granting access to sensitive information. Firewalls and intrusion detection systems are also important tools in cybersecurity programming to monitor and block malicious activity.
Best Practices in Cybersecurity Programming
To create robust cybersecurity programs, it is essential to follow best practices such as regularly updating software to patch vulnerabilities, using strong passwords, implementing multi-factor authentication, and conducting regular security audits. It is also crucial to stay informed about the latest cyber threats and trends to adapt and improve security measures.
The Future of Cybersecurity Programming
As technology advances and cyber threats evolve, the field of cybersecurity programming will continue to grow in importance. With the rise of artificial intelligence and machine learning, cybersecurity programs can become smarter and more adaptive in detecting and defending against cyber attacks. It is crucial for aspiring cybersecurity programmers to stay updated on the latest technologies and trends in the industry.
In conclusion, understanding the concept of cybersecurity programming is crucial in today’s digital world to protect our online data and privacy. By mastering programming languages and techniques, we can develop secure systems that safeguard against cyber threats. We hope this blog post has provided valuable insights into the world of cybersecurity programming. Share your thoughts and experiences with us in the comments below.